The tenants have filed the present revision application under the proviso to section 14(8) of the Bihar Buildings (Lease, Rent & Eviction) Control Act, 1982, (hereinafter referred to as the Act), challenging the judgment and decree dated 17.7.2001 passed in Title Eviction Suit No. 30 of 1997, whereby the court below has decreed the suit of the plaintiff-opposite parties for eviction with regard to the properly detailed in Schedule-A of the plaint on the ground of personal necessity under section 11(1)(c) of the Act.
2. The suit premises consists of a shop (Katra) facing the main road and bearing holding no. 35, Circle no. 180, Ward no. 32. situated in Muhalla Jhauganj. P.S. Chawk, Patnacity, Patna. The case of the plaintiffs is that they are the land-lords and the father. of the defendants was inducted as tenant in the said shop on a monthly rental of Rs. 300/- and the last rent was paid up to the month of March, 1996. Thereafter, they stopped the payment of rent. Plaintiff no. 1 was in service and he retired in the year 1993.
